Transaction 26321f53f280e1effc591f3785ed7969dbb826c99a76d98bb23f5e78ca1ecdb4
1 Input
1 Output
-
26321f53f280e1effc591f3785ed7969dbb826c99a76d98bb23f5e78ca1ecdb4:0
- value
- 179405
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2404147a4fe1c7be571b8e522adebbd4d66b2cd1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14HSDPYTmUuemBHrdcCBmhTK5qhm7JDPeU